Darius Robinson, EDGE, Missouri

Size:

Height: 6’5”

Weight: 285 pounds

Arm Length: 34 1/2"

Hand Size: 10 5/8"

Accomplishments:

First Team All-SEC (2023)

“One of the draft’s premier run defenders, Darius Robinson’s power and evolving pass-rush approach will quickly pave the way for snaps in the NFL.”

Strengths:

  • Physical at the point of attack 

  • Technician against run (stack/shed)

  • Rip/swipe vs. both run/pass

  • Inside/out pass rush repertoire

Concerns:

  • Over-reliant on power

  • Flexibility

Film Analysis: 

A 5-tech inside the Missouri defense, Darius Robinson is an extremely advanced run defender whose physicality pops off the screen. Robinson has a mature, NFL-ready frame—he is well-proportioned and has good overall length. 

Robinson's skill set against the run will allow him to be an immediate contributor in countering the run at the next level. Spring-loaded hands consistently knock opposing linemen back. Utilizes an excellent rip and two-hand swipe to work his way into the backfield (Tennessee). Stack/shed ability is evident and consistently faced double teams on runs to his side. Sets the edge nicely and has the athleticism to play from the backside, also.

As a pass rusher, Robinson displays heavy hands and the power to relocate opposing tackles. Will have to improve his pass-rush repertoire to consistently push the pocket, but his bull rush will cause issues for tackles with a weak anchor. High-level explosiveness is lacking off the line of scrimmage, but his pure strength and quick hands to win inside/out make life tough for linemen. Has shown the ability to align as both an even and odd-front defensive end. 

Robinson’s primary concerns center around his short-area quickness/twitch and tightness in his lower half. The quickness affects his ability to win around the arc with speed.  Feet will also stop at times if rush plan is halted early in the rep (Tennessee). Will occasionally dip and make first contact with his head in his bull rush, vacating his vision and ability to read and react to his immediate surroundings (LSU). 

Prospect Projection: Day 2 — Adequate Starter

Exposures: Georgia (2023), Tennessee (2023), Kentucky (2023), LSU (2023)
